Output 15215e18573b6d23adf55554baac1f348f6b4ea19ca94785268c60ca93e32646:3

value
3501089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4767d31049346c577fb17f2e20c01773b3f9b375 OP_EQUAL
address
38CaH1muZDUq9zbXQgkZcHAoJpZQYvuzAJ
transaction
15215e18573b6d23adf55554baac1f348f6b4ea19ca94785268c60ca93e32646
spent
true